A document-writing tool for creating or updating numbered task documents. It uses information from the repository, a DOCTEMPLATE.md file, and the project's naming rules.

In plain words
What is it for?
Use it to create numbered task documents, revise existing ones, and follow a repository's documentation template and naming conventions.
Why use it?
It keeps task documents consistent with the existing repository instead of requiring you to discover the format and conventions each time.

Per session 22 Skills are progressive disclosure: only the name and description are preloaded; the body loads when the skill is used.
When invoked 313 The whole file, excluding the scripts and references it only reads on demand.
Security scan A 0 findings. A grade says what 26 rules found in the file — not that it is safe.

doc-writer scanned grade A with 0 findings against 26 rules in 11 categories — prompt injection, anti-refusal, data exfiltration, privilege escalation, supply chain, agent snooping, system-prompt leakage, SSRF and excessive agency — measured 10d ago.

A static scan of the body, not an audit. Every finding is printed with the line that produced it so you can judge whether it matters here. A mod is markdown that instructs an agent; that is exactly why what it instructs is worth reading.

Nothing flagged

None of the 26 patterns this scan looks for appear in this file: no shell pipes, no recursive deletes, no credential paths, no hidden text, no instruction-override or anti-refusal phrasing, no agent-config snooping. That is not a guarantee, it is the absence of the things that are checkable.
